Job Description Summary

The Director, Software Engineering leads the development of innovative technology products used by hundreds of thousands of students. They ensure quality solutions are delivered on time, within budget, and within scope, manage teams, and employ AI to improve software quality and velocity.

Essential Functions And Responsibilities

  • Ensure software development teams consistently deliver quality solutions on time, within budget, and within scope.
  • Drive the full software development life cycle, including requirements analysis, feasibility estimates, design, coding, documentation, testing, implementation, and support.
  • Develop project plans, manage resource planning, oversee scheduling, and monitor development timelines.
  • Build, lead, and manage multidisciplinary software engineering teams and AI coding/testing agents, ensuring development processes adhere to industry best practices.
  • Oversee the quality and process of design reviews, code reviews, and mentoring efforts to support team growth and technical excellence.
  • Support change management processes related to software releases, application patching, and production configuration changes.
  • Manage multiple priorities in high-pressure environments while identifying and resolving issues early to reduce project risk, cost, and timeline impacts.
  • Provide oversight and management of department expenses, budget planning, and resource allocation.
